El Granada sits on the San Mateo County coast, just north of Half Moon Bay and south of Montara, with a population hovering around 5,700. The town is split by Highway 1, with the coastal side featuring the Miramar and Princeton-by-the-Sea areas, while the inland side climbs toward the foothills of the Santa Cruz Mountains. Locals deal with persistent marine layer fog and salty ocean air, especially in the summer months, which can leave a fine mineral residue on windows, floors, and doorknobs.
Because many El Granada homes are older mid-century builds with large decks and picture windows facing the ocean, dust and grit from nearby bluffs and the harbor at Pillar Point easily settle inside. Add in the sand tracked in from surfing at Miramar Beach or fishing trips at Princeton Harbor, and floors and rugs take a real beating. Regular professional house cleaning helps residents—many of whom commute to tech jobs on the Peninsula—stay on top of the coastal grime without sacrificing their weekends.
